Woman Charged With Murder Of 4-Year-Old Catawba County Girl Is Denied Bond Reduction

April 3, 2025 By Richard C. Gilbert

Chelsea Lee Crompton

A woman charged with murder of a 4-year-old in Catawba County has been denied a bail reduction.

36-year-old Chelsea Crompton of Marshall in Madison County is charged with the death of 4-year-old Hazel Lidey. Hazel died on Nov. 20, 2022 in Catawba County. Crompton was arrested several days later.

Crompton’s attorney filed a motion to have bond reduced from $750,000 to $50,000. Superior Court Judge Karen Eady-Williams denied Goelling’s request on Tuesday. The judge stated the request was denied until a report from the defense’s forensic pathologist’s is finalized. A pathologist is tasked with reviewing Hazel Lidey’s autopsy. Crompton was the girlfriend of Hazel’s father, Christopher James Lidey when the death took place.

On November 17, 2022, Catawba County Sheriff’s Office Deputies responded to 4157 Hill Haven Drive to a reported child overdose. Emergency medical personnel told the arriving deputies that Hazel Lidey had traumatic injuries and bruising all over her body, according to a search warrant.

Crompton remains in the Catawba County Jail.
